_Attribut MFSampleExtension LongTermReferenceFrameInfo

Spécifie les informations de trame de référence à long terme et est retourné sur l’exemple de sortie.

Type de données

UINT32

Notes

Encodeurs H. 264/AVC :

Les encodeurs retournent cet attribut sur l’exemple de sortie lorsque l’application contrôle les frames LTR, qui est spécifié par CODECAPI _ AVEncVideoLTRBufferControl.

MFSampleExtension _ LongTermReferenceFrameInfo retourne jusqu’à deux champs.

Le premier champ, bits [ 0.. 15 ] , est LongTermFrameIdx associé au frame de sortie s’il est marqué comme cadre LTR. La première valeur est 0xFFFF, si ce frame de sortie est une trame de référence à bref terme ou un frame non-référence.

Le deuxième champ, bits [ 16.. 31 ] , est une image bitmap composée de MaxNumLTRFrames de nombreux bits qui indiquent le ou les frames LTR utilisés pour l’encodage de ce frame de sortie, à partir du bit 16. Le reste de bits doit être défini sur 0. La deuxième valeur est 0 si cette trame de sortie n’est pas encodée à l’aide d’une trame LTR. MaxNumLTRFrames est le nombre maximal de frames LTR définis via CODECAPI _ AVEncVideoLTRBufferControl.

Spécifications

Condition requise Valeur
Client minimal pris en charge
[applications Windows 8.1 desktop apps | UWP]
Serveur minimal pris en charge
Windows Server 2012 Applications de [ Bureau R2 | applications UWP]
En-tête
Mfapi. h

Voir aussi

Liste alphabétique des attributs Media Foundation